甘肃河西走廓不同生境中鼠类群落结构初步研究

摘    要:本文对河西走廓不同生境中鼠类群落的物种组成和多样性进行了初步研究,在6种生境中进行了定量调查和采集,共获13种标本,隶于6(亚)科9属,其中古北界种类占优势。多样性分析结果表明:6种生境的物种丰富度指数RMargaler在.6139-1.9689之间。Shannon-Wiener指数(H')为1.0695-1.5607,Pielou旨数(J')和Simpson指数(D)分别为0.7242-0.9735和0.2768-0.4683,不同生境的丰富种数量(N1)变化趋势与H'相似,而非常丰富种数量(N2)的变化趋势为:半莫荒灌丛生境>山地草原生境>戈壁荒漠生境>农田生境>森林生境>山地半荒漠灌丛生境。降水对不同生境类型中鼠类群落物种组成和多样性起直接的限制作用,同时海拔和人类干扰也是影响的因素。

Diversity of rodents communities in different habitats in Hexi Corridor, Gansu Province

Abstract:Species diversity of rodents is a good index to analyze local environmental change, since rodents have not only the ability to adapt to a wide range of habitats but also are sensitive to environmental changes. In order to understand the influence of habitat types on rodent diversity, the species composition and diversity of rodent communities in six different habitats in Hexi Corridor were studied. Field work was carried out from July to August, 2001. Rodents (<200 g ) were sampled with 2 dimensional grids in all habitats. Average distance between grids was 100 m. One hundred snap traps were set for for two days in each sample line with 5 m spacing. A total of 5320 trap nights were operated in six habitats. Traps were baited in the afternoon with peanuts and were checked the next morning. Thirteen species of rodents among 354 individuals were collected, belonging to six families (or subfamilies) and nine genera. Species associated with palaercitic fauna dominated the community. The result of diversity analysis shows that the values of the species richness index R Margalef for the six habitats ranged from 0.6139 to 1.9689, while the species diversity index (Shannon Wiener index) ranged from 1.0695 to 1.5607, and Pielou and Simpson indices ranged from 0.7242 to 0.9735 and from 0.2768 to 0.4683, respectively. The tendency of diversity, including N 1 and the Shannon Wiener index, was for similarity in all six habitats, while the tendency of N 2 was such that habitats of semi desert brush > habitats of mountainous grassland > habitats of desert > habitats of cultivated fields > habitats of forest > habitats of semi desert mountain brush. Precipitation was the major restricted factor that directly influenced species composition and diversity for the rodent community in these habitats. Latitude and human disturbance also affect species composition of the rodent community.
